  • Counting Carbs Correctly

    I'm making roasted cauliflower to go with my grilled pork chops. MMMM

    I'm wondering about counting the carbs correctly. I'm allowing 1 cup of cauliflower as my "other veggie". That's 5 carbs. But that's if it is fresh cauliflower, right?

    I'm using an entire frozen bag and it says 3 carbs each serving. There are 4 servings. So that's 12 carbs total. Then the fiber says 2 carbs per serving. So that's 8 fiber... subtract that from the carbs.. you get 4 carbs total for the bag.

    So I count the entire bag as 4. Right?

          If it's something whole foods like cauliflower, I'd go by the label on the bag BUT if a package of food has added ingredients which are carbs, often the label will have rounded down the grams of carbs per serving. FDA allows this -if the amout is under 1/2 gram they can legally put in a zero. So companies wishing to take advantage of this have in some cases simply reduced package size and stated portion size to make that "0 carbs" advertising possible!

          "(6) Carbohydrate, total" or "Total carbohydrate": A statement of the number of grams of total carbohydrate in a serving expressed to the nearest gram, except that if a serving contains less than 1 gram, the statement "Contains less than 1 gram" or "less than 1 gram" may be used as an alternative, or if the serving contains less than 0.5 gram, the content may be expressed as zero. Total carbohydrate content shall be calculated by subtraction of the sum of the crude protein, total fat, moisture, and ash from the total weight of the food. This calculation method is described in A. L. Merrill and B. K. Watt, "Energy Value of Foods--Basis and Derivation," USDA Handbook 74 (slightly revised 1973) pp. 2 and 3, which is incorporated by reference in accordance with 5 U.S.C. 552(a) and 1 CFR part 51 (the availability of this incorporation by reference is given in paragraph (c)(1)(i)(A) of this section)."
